Ecological Suitability Evaluation of Rosa Damascene Ⅲ in Sichuan Province and Benefit Analysis of Its Introduction into Xichang,China

  The ecological suitability of Rosa damascene Ⅲ in Sichuan Province,China was assessed based on the fuzzy comprehensive evaluation and Geographic Information System (GIS) using relevant indexes such as average annual temperature,average annual rainfall,and soil pH.The weight of each index was calculated by integrating the subjective weight and the entropy weight.Results showed that Sichuan Province was divided into three regions,including suitable,subsuitable and nonsuitable regions for growing R.damascene III.This provided a scientific basis for introduction of R.damascene III into Sichuan Province.Accordingly,we selected one of the suitable regions – Xichang as the introduction test site.Together with excellent regional cultivation management conditions,the introduction of R.damascene Ⅲ gained substantial economic benefits,social benefits and ecological benefits.
